云虚拟主机运行速度慢吗?这是一个非常普遍且关键的问题,尤其当您正在为网站选择托管方案时,简单地说:云虚拟主机本身不一定慢,但它的速度表现高度依赖于多种因素。 将其一概而论地贴上“快”或“慢”的标签是不准确的。
理解云虚拟主机的速度,需要了解它的工作原理:它将一台强大的物理服务器(或服务器集群)的资源(CPU、内存、存储、带宽)通过虚拟化技术划分成多个独立的“虚拟空间”供不同用户使用,这种共享资源的模式,既是其成本效益高的原因,也是速度表现可能产生波动的根源。
影响云虚拟主机速度的关键因素:
-
资源配置(CPU、内存、带宽):
- 核心因素: 这是最直接的影响点,您购买的套餐所分配的CPU核心数、内存大小和带宽限制,直接决定了您的网站在处理访问请求、运行程序(如PHP脚本、数据库查询)以及传输数据时的能力上限。
- 瓶颈所在: 如果您的网站流量增长、安装了资源消耗大的插件/应用,或者进行了复杂的数据库操作,而资源配额不足,服务器响应就会变慢,页面加载时间显著增加,这就像一条高速公路,车流量(访问量)超过了车道数(资源),必然拥堵。
-
服务器硬件与性能:
- 底层基础: 云虚拟主机的性能最终受限于其所在的物理服务器(或集群)的硬件质量,优质的云服务商会使用最新的高性能CPU(如Intel Xeon Scalable系列)、高速SSD固态硬盘(NVMe SSD最佳)、充足的内存和优化的网络基础设施。
- SSD vs HDD: 存储类型至关重要。强烈推荐选择使用SSD(固态硬盘)的云虚拟主机。 SSD在数据读写速度上比传统HDD(机械硬盘)快几个数量级,能极大提升网站文件读取、数据库查询的速度。
-
服务器位置与网络质量:
- 物理距离: 服务器机房的地理位置离您的目标访客越远,数据传输所需的时间(网络延迟)就越长,选择靠近您主要用户群体的数据中心位置非常重要。
- 网络线路: 服务商提供的网络带宽质量、是否接入优质骨干网、是否提供BGP多线接入(确保不同运营商用户访问速度)都会影响连接速度和稳定性。
-
邻居效应(“坏邻居”问题):
- 共享环境的挑战: 在共享的云虚拟主机环境中,您的“邻居”网站如果消耗了大量共享资源(如CPU、I/O),可能会影响到您网站的性能,虽然虚拟化技术旨在隔离资源,但在资源争用激烈时,性能仍可能受到牵连。
- 服务商管理: 负责任的服务商会通过监控、资源限制和良好的超售策略来尽量减轻这种影响。
-
网站本身的优化程度:
- 内部因素: 即使服务器资源充足,一个臃肿、未优化的网站也会很慢,这包括:
- 未优化的图片/媒体: 巨大的图片文件是拖慢加载速度的头号元凶。
- 臃肿的代码/主题/插件: 低效的代码、功能过多或编码不佳的主题/插件会消耗大量服务器资源。
- 缺乏缓存: 没有启用有效的缓存机制(如页面缓存、对象缓存、浏览器缓存),导致每次访问都需要动态生成页面,增加服务器负担。
- 数据库未优化: 数据库查询效率低下、表未优化、索引缺失等。
- 外部资源加载缓慢: 引用了加载慢的第三方脚本(如广告、统计代码、社交媒体插件)。
- 内部因素: 即使服务器资源充足,一个臃肿、未优化的网站也会很慢,这包括:
-
服务商的技术架构与优化:
- 软件栈优化: 服务商是否对Web服务器(如Nginx/Apache)、PHP版本及配置(如OPcache)、数据库(如MySQL/MariaDB)进行了针对性能的优化。
- 资源隔离技术: 采用更先进的虚拟化技术(如KVM)和资源控制机制(如cgroups)能提供更好的资源隔离和稳定性。
- 流量管理与防护: 是否具备有效的DDoS防护和流量管理能力,防止恶意流量或突发高峰压垮服务器。
如何确保您的云虚拟主机运行更快?
- 选择合适的套餐: 根据您网站的预期流量、功能需求(如WordPress、电商平台)预留足够的资源余量,不要一味追求最低配置,关注套餐的CPU核心数、内存大小、带宽限制和是否使用SSD。
- 优先选择SSD存储: 这是提升速度最直接有效的方式之一。
- 关注数据中心位置: 选择靠近您主要访客群体的服务商数据中心。
- 选择信誉良好、技术实力强的服务商: 研究服务商的口碑、用户评价、使用的硬件和技术架构,知名且专注于优化的服务商通常能提供更稳定快速的体验。
- 优化您的网站:
- 压缩优化图片: 使用工具减小图片文件大小,采用现代格式(如WebP)。
- 启用缓存: 务必使用服务商提供的缓存功能或安装缓存插件(如WP Super Cache, W3 Total Cache for WordPress)。
- 精简主题和插件: 只保留必要的插件,删除或替换臃肿、低效的主题和插件,定期更新。
- 优化代码: 精简HTML, CSS, JavaScript文件(合并、压缩)。
- 优化数据库: 定期清理冗余数据(如修订版、垃圾评论),优化数据库表。
- 使用CDN(内容分发网络): 强烈推荐! CDN将您的静态资源(图片、CSS, JS)缓存到全球各地的边缘节点,让用户从最近的节点获取内容,显著减少延迟,提升加载速度,并减轻源服务器负担,Cloudflare、阿里云CDN、酷盾CDN等都是常用选择。
- 减少HTTP请求数: 合并文件、使用CSS Sprites等。
- 选择轻量级的解决方案: 在满足需求的前提下,考虑更轻量的CMS或框架。
云虚拟主机速度 ≠ 固定值
云虚拟主机作为一种成熟且广泛应用的托管方案,其速度潜力是巨大的,它本身的技术架构并非速度慢的根源。关键在于您选择的资源配置、服务商的硬件/网络/技术实力,以及您自身对网站的优化程度。
一个配置合理(尤其是SSD)、部署在优质网络节点、由技术实力强的服务商提供、并且自身经过良好优化的网站,在云虚拟主机上完全可以获得非常快速流畅的访问体验,反之,如果选择了资源不足的套餐、服务商质量差、或者网站本身臃肿不堪,那么速度慢就是必然的结果。
在问“云虚拟主机慢吗?”之前,更重要的是问:“我选择的套餐资源够吗?服务商靠谱吗?我的网站优化好了吗?” 做好这三方面的功课,云虚拟主机完全可以成为您网站高速运行的可靠基石。
引用说明:
- 本文中关于网站速度对用户体验和转化率影响的论述,参考了业界普遍认知和多项用户研究(Google等机构的研究表明,页面加载时间超过3秒会导致跳出率显著增加)。
- 关于SSD性能优势、CDN工作原理及效益的阐述,基于计算机硬件和网络传输的基础知识及主流服务商(如AWS, Google Cloud, 阿里云, 酷盾, Cloudflare)提供的公开技术文档和最佳实践建议。
- 网站优化建议部分综合了Web性能优化(WPO)领域的通用准则和最佳实践,参考来源包括Google Developers的Web Fundamentals、WebPageTest.org的建议以及主流CMS(如WordPress)社区的优化经验。
原创文章,发布者:酷盾叔,转转请注明出处:https://www.kd.cn/ask/30189.html